A catalytic effect of amines on the reaction of arenesulfinic acids with N, N'-thiodiphthalimide.

摘要

In the presence of catalytic amounts of several amines, N, N′-thiodiphthalimide has been allowed to react with one or two equiv. of arenesulfinic acids in dichloromethane, thus giving N-(arylsulfonylthio) phthalimides or bis (arenesulfonyl) sulfides respectively in good yields. The arenesulfinate anion seems to be a better nucleophile against N, N′-thiodiphthalimide than arenesulfinic acid. The mechanism of the catalytic reaction will be discussed.
